    Assignment: Light and Shadows - “Temptation”

    Techs: A Circular Polarize filter was used at 50 percent capacity, to tone down the reflections and to give the image a deep, silky, rich glow.

    The image was painted with a Nikon D2x; using a Nikkor AF-S DX Zoom 17-55mm f/2.8G IF-ED.

    Image Solution:
    focal length @ 32mm / exposure mode @ aperture priority / 1/60sec. - f/4 / exposure comp @ -0.3EV / ISO @ 320 / white balance @ auto. / AF - mode @ manual / metering mode - combination of in camera matrix metering, and hand held spot meter, sampling three anchor points, for balanced light distribution. / color space @ sRGB / lighting solution - Nikon R1C1 wireless close up speedlight system; both light units set to ¼ lumen burst with a wide dispersal pattern. / tone comp @ +0 degree / hue adjustment @ +1 degree / saturation factor @ +2 degrees / support platform – tripod assist, with macro focusing rail, and a cable trigger release /
